Ministry of Labour to intensify inspections at workplaces in Oman

The Ministry of Labour has clarified about videos that were circulated on social media regarding evacuation of offices from expat workforces who have violated in a number of private sector establishments.

“In light of the videos that were circulated regarding the evacuation of offices from the expat workforces who have violated in a number of private sector establishments when the judicial control officers’ inspection visits. The Ministry of Labour would like to extend its sincere thanks to everyone who interacted in these videos, which shows the full and conscious care of the employees for the damage these practices caused in the labour market. By following up on these circulating videos, it was found that they date back to extremely old times,” the Ministry of Labour said.

The Ministry of Labour added that it is also not possible to verify that those videos were filmed before or during the period when the judicial officers conducted the inspection visits in those facilities.

The Ministry confirms that it is proceeding with inspection plans to monitor violations of the labour law in a manner that ensures the organisation of the labour market, and that it is fully prepared to cooperate in this aspect.
